Transaction 59d0e54b9768da99a110bba4050bb2f4fffcc93d71689b4429c4fd012b61f1ec

1 Input
2 Outputs
  • 59d0e54b9768da99a110bba4050bb2f4fffcc93d71689b4429c4fd012b61f1ec:0
  • value  11535863
    address  1MeyXH2UNivT23CBXYBUcyUC21yGE3rLtQ
  • 59d0e54b9768da99a110bba4050bb2f4fffcc93d71689b4429c4fd012b61f1ec:1
  • value  45596551
    address  bc1qdw52udwsuc0hgwnk33pjaht9vddle7pnzer003